Output ddc5e9603c859dd3fb33b54dd706c1a678cc5e94bd403b17fc4a176be75ca103:0

value
15380000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bd50504efeed805d0d708ec836731ecc031392d OP_EQUALVERIFY OP_CHECKSIG
address
14zmF7QZAC9gg3dK995T7MHpRrWV1tVDsy
transaction
ddc5e9603c859dd3fb33b54dd706c1a678cc5e94bd403b17fc4a176be75ca103
confirmations
605273
spent
true